The sump pump is the key component of any dry basement. When putting in a sump pump, the "sump pit" is put in the ground, while the "pump" is the part that powers the drainage of the overflow through the discharge line. During a storm, often a sump pump will stop working due to a loss of electric. Our Sump Pump battery backup will ensure that the water gets moved out of your home or subsurface structures and sent to the discharge line. It is highly recommended to have a sump pump battery backup. When the main pump stops working or break, the battery back up will continue to work for you when you are experiencing heavy rains or power issues, and your basement will continue to stay dry.
